   This change allows for providing custom calcite rules from extensions to 
participate in query planning. The custom rules from extensions could be used 
to either do logical transformations for a query plan (some org specific 
optimization or experiment through a custom extension) or physical 
transformations (custom native query planning).
   
   For adding a custom rule, the extension will require an implementation of 
`DruidExtensionCalciteRuleProvider` which will provide the custom rule. Along 
with that, it would be required to bind that rule provider via a guice 
multibinder to `ExtensionCalciteRuleProvider` annotation. 
   An example binding would look like : 
   `Multibinder.newSetBinder(binder, DruidExtensionCalciteRuleProvider.class, 
ExtensionCalciteRuleProvider.class).addBinding().toInstance(<provider-instance>)`
